I'm blogging this on a weird little machine. It has green plastic keys (so forgive any typos), two little green ears, a screen about a third of an A4 page and is dead cool. It is the One Laptop per Child XO - a cheap machine to take to millions world wide.
Its very hardy (hence lots of durable features like the key pad), and can do wifi over 1 km. It has in-built USB-stick memory, so no moving parts, so long battery life. It's a bit difficult to use, if you're used to very high spec machine. But it has proven you can have web and everything ready for lots to bridge the digital divide.
